Pre-Register for Nice Mini-Conference

Be sure to pre-register now for the 18th Annual NICE Mini-Conference.

This conference is well worth attending (especially at a $5 fee!). Details:

Saturday, Jan. 28, 2012
8 am to 1 pm
Adlai E. Stevenson High School
Lincolnshire, IL.

Many of us have attended in the past and would encourage you to take advantage of this learning opportunity.

Is there interest in generating an Unconference?

It seems to me that what we are all about in AM Exchange is grass-roots professional development. We already embrace the move away from expert-driven learning to self-authorized learning. We already know that their are expert voices among us at New Trier who are capable of differentiation in meeting the goals/needs of other teachers. And, we already sense that professional development for teachers is most powerful when it is more personal, social, and voluntary.


These are the concepts which drive the Unconference model. Read the thoughtful blog post
"Unconference: Revolutionary Professional Learning" from M.E. Steele-Pierce who describes how unconferencing works, why it matters and how to set it up so that professional development doesn't "stink".
